The invention provides a novel process for producing a 3,5-difluoroaniline compound by reacting a 2-halo-4,6-difluoroaniline with a diazotizing agent in the presence of a reducing agent to form a diazonium salt. Build-up of potentially dangerous diazonium salt is avoided by reducing the diazonium salt with the reducing agent, to form a 1-halo-3,5- difluorobenzene, contemporaneously with the diazotization reaction. The 1-halo-3,5-difluorobenzene is then aminated.
